APS5 Operations Officer - Compliance Management Group
THE OPPORTUNITY
We have an exciting opportunity for Operations Officers to join the Aged Care Quality and Safety Commission. We are seeking candidates with strong analytical and organisational skills that have a proven track record of project managing or coordinating business improvement initiatives.
The successful candidate will need to have strong problem-solving and stakeholder management skills to consult relevant stakeholders, review business/team requirements, identify gaps and risks, and deliver successful outcomes.
The role will assist with implementing the group’s operational assurance program and taking ownership of the workforce plan, and recruitment and retention strategy. This will also include administration coordination of the recruitment, onboarding, and induction for staff within the group.
The Operations Officer – Compliance Management Group role sits within the Compliance Management Group Operations section which leads the groups’ workforce plan and building capability across the group. The section also coordinated the development and implementation of operational procedures and quality assurance for the group.

Merit Pool
A merit pool of suitable candidates may be created from this selection process. Suitable candidates placed on the merit pool may be contacted in relation to identical or similar vacancies on a non-ongoing and ongoing basis at the Commission, or the broader APS, within 18 months from the start date of this advertisement.
Non-ongoing opportunities may be offered with an initial engagement of up to 18 months, with one possible extension of up to 6 months (a total maximum contract period of 2 years).
